JACKSONVILLE, Fla. – The Jacksonville Sheriff’s Office is highlighting a 28-year-old murder of JSO detective Lonnie Miller, hoping someone in the community leads them to find the killer. Detective Miller was killed while responding to a burglary call on May 6, 1995. The burglary call was at Miller’s friend’s business…Read More
